Beach litter originating from national land-based sources that ends in Western Europe, 2017–2022
Source: United Nations Statistics Division, SDG Global Database.
Analysis
The most recent figure for beach litter originating from national land-based sources that ends in Western Europe is 10,069, measured in 2022.
That represents a change of down 7.7% on the previous year and down 4.0% over ten years.
That places Western Europe 26th out of 28 groups with data for 2022, putting it in the bottom quarter.
Beach litter originating from national land-based sources that ends in Western Europe,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2017 | 10,494 | — |
| 2018 | 8,954 | -14.7% |
| 2019 | 9,508 | +6.2% |
| 2020 | 10,612 | +11.6% |
| 2021 | 10,912 | +2.8% |
| 2022 | 10,069 | -7.7% |
